We run Postgres7.3.2 on a OpenBSD34
I try to connect to the postgres database from winxp boxes using postgres odbc driver ver. 7.02.00.05
and then create a user dsn and then use a Borland Delphi tool called ODBCTest and try
but i get message "FATAL : no pg_hba.conf entry for host 192.168.228.59 user postgres database template1". and than try to edit pg_hba.conf and added command "host template1 postgres 192.168.228.59 255.255.255.0 trust" but still doesn't work. so I missed something with ODBC?
